The Three Pillars of DVT

Now, what leads to DVT? It’s a cocktail of three main factors—yes, I said cocktail. Let’s take a closer look at these ingredients:

  1. Venous Stasis: This fancy term refers to when blood flow slows down or stops. Imagine a traffic jam where cars just can’t move; that’s what happens to blood in our veins during prolonged immobility, like sitting for hours on a plane or after surgery.

  2. Vessel Wall Injury: Any damage to the lining of the blood vessels can easily invite trouble. This could stem from surgeries or traumatic injuries. Think of it as a struggle for your vessel walls, which need to stay intact in order to keep blood flowing smoothly.

  3. Hypercoagulability: Whew, quite a mouthful, right? Basically, it means the blood has a tendency to clot more than usual. This can be due to genetic predispositions, certain medications, or underlying health conditions. It’s like making a cake with too much baking powder—things just get a bit too fluffy, leading to unexpected results.

Together, these three factors create the perfect storm for DVT. Recognizing this connection isn’t just academic; it’s essential for real-world clinical practice.
